Understanding Alcohol Metabolism
Alcohol metabolism is a complex process that varies significantly from person to person. When a person consumes alcohol, it enters the bloodstream quickly, affecting various organs and systems. The body primarily metabolizes alcohol through the liver, where enzymes break it down into acetaldehyde and then into acetic acid before being eliminated. This metabolic process is crucial in understanding how soon alcohol can affect breast milk.
The rate at which alcohol is metabolized can depend on several factors, including age, sex, body weight, genetic factors, and overall health. Generally, the average adult metabolizes alcohol at a rate of about one standard drink per hour. However, this can vary widely among individuals.

Alcohol Absorption and Its Effects
When alcohol is consumed, it doesn’t take long to enter the bloodstream. Once in the bloodstream, it can cross into breast milk due to its similar composition. The concentration of alcohol in breast milk typically mirrors that in the mother’s blood.
Several factors influence how quickly alcohol reaches breast milk:
1. Timing of Consumption
The time taken for alcohol to reach breast milk varies based on when a mother feeds her baby relative to her drinking session. If a mother consumes alcohol shortly before breastfeeding, the baby may ingest milk with higher levels of alcohol.
2. Type of Alcohol
Different alcoholic beverages have varying concentrations of alcohol. For instance, a shot of whiskey contains more alcohol than a glass of wine or beer. Thus, stronger drinks will lead to higher concentrations in breast milk more quickly.
3. Quantity Consumed
The amount of alcohol consumed plays a significant role in how soon it reaches breast milk and its concentration levels. A single drink results in lower levels compared to multiple drinks consumed within a short period.
4. Individual Metabolism
Each person’s metabolism affects how quickly they process alcohol. Factors such as liver health and genetic predispositions can lead to variations in absorption rates.

The Impact on Breastfeeding Infants
The presence of alcohol in breast milk raises concerns for many breastfeeding mothers regarding their infants’ health and safety. Here are some key points regarding potential effects:
Cognitive Development Risks
Studies suggest that infants exposed to high levels of alcohol through breast milk may experience cognitive development issues over time. While occasional light drinking might not pose significant risks, heavy or frequent consumption could lead to long-term developmental challenges.
Sleep Patterns Disruption
Alcohol can also disrupt an infant’s sleep patterns when consumed by nursing mothers. Babies may sleep less soundly or wake more frequently if they consume milk containing even trace amounts of alcohol.
Nutritional Concerns
Breastfeeding is crucial for an infant’s nutrition during the first year of life; thus, introducing substances like alcohol can interfere with essential nutrient absorption and overall health.
Recommendations for Breastfeeding Mothers
To ensure both safety for the infant and enjoyment for the mother when consuming alcoholic beverages, several recommendations exist:
Pacing Consumption
If choosing to drink while breastfeeding, pacing consumption is essential. Allowing sufficient time between drinking and feeding can help minimize the amount of alcohol present in breast milk during nursing sessions.
Selecting Appropriate Times for Drinking
Planning drinking sessions around feeding schedules can be beneficial. For instance, having a drink right after breastfeeding allows time for metabolism before the next feeding session.
Limiting Quantity/strong>
Moderation is key when it comes to drinking while breastfeeding. Limiting alcoholic intake reduces potential risks associated with higher concentrations of alcohol in breast milk.
Misinformation About Alcohol and Breastfeeding
There are many myths surrounding breastfeeding mothers consuming alcoholic beverages that need clarification:
“Pumping and Dumping”
Many believe that “pumping and dumping” will remove all traces of alcohol from breast milk; however, this practice does not speed up the elimination process since it does not change blood or milk concentrations already present.
“Beer Increases Milk Supply”
Another common myth suggests that beer increases milk supply; however, studies indicate no significant evidence supporting this claim.
Understanding these misconceptions allows mothers to make informed decisions about their choices regarding drinking while breastfeeding without falling prey to misinformation.
